Now, while these can be very informative and inspirational, I do feel - with the benefit of a little recent experience under my belt - that many of the blogs and channels can be horrendously overly-romanticised, in true social-media fashion, glorifying the lifestyle and focusing only on the picturesque backdrops and filtered photos of beachfront views from open doors, empty winding roads as far as the eye can see, and an accompaniment of "uplifting" hashtags and quotes.
Something I feel is lacking however, certainly understated at least, are blogs and channels which give a realistic, gritty, unpolished, raw outlook at this lifestyle - the trials and tribulations, the compromises, hardships, rainy days and blood, sweat and tears. The sense of freedom certainly isn't without it's fair share of work.
So I thought I'd start my own. There are others out there of course - I follow many of them - but I wanted my own input on that, to share my own experiences. For a couple of reasons; firstly for myself as a form of diary - as mentioned I am very new to this, being less than 2 months in. I'm not a seasoned van-dweller, and I'm learning and adapting to this lifestyle every day, and I'm sure I'll look back on these days in the months to come with a little smirk at how green I was - and I'd like to immortalise my inexperience for future prosperity and self deprecation. Secondly, as a means of keeping my family, friends, people I meet, and interested parties updated on how I unconventionally live and deal with lifes day-to-day tasks. And lastly, for anyone else researching for their own impending journey - if others can learn only one thing from my mistakes, and it can save them from making them themselves, they can thank me later!
